Description
A comforting dish of roasted sweet potatoes glazed with maple syrup and topped with crunchy walnuts, perfect for family gatherings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 lbs sweet potatoes, peeled and cubed
- 1/4 cup pure maple syrup
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1 cup walnuts, roughly chopped
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Peel and chop the sweet potatoes into even cubes, about an inch thick.
- In a large bowl, combine the sweet potato cubes with maple syrup, olive oil, cinnamon, and nutmeg, tossing until coated.
- Spread the mixture on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, ensuring even spacing.
- Roast for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through.
- Add walnuts during the last 10 minutes of roasting.
- Drizzle with additional maple syrup before serving.
Notes
Avoid overcrowding the baking sheet to ensure even roasting. Allow the sweet potatoes to cool slightly for the best flavor.
